We’re rekindling Charlottesville Classical on WTJU 91.1 FM

Starting next Monday, July 13, WTJU’s classical department becomes Charlottesville Classical, your arts companion for our community.

It’s radio for lovers of good music and curious seekers of new musical experiences. It’s radio for people who value our local community — yet who sometimes need a break from the bleakest of the news.

It’s radio for people like you.

Charlottesville Classical will ease you into your day with classical music every weekday morning, 5 – 9 a.m., presented by your friends and neighbors.

Each weekday, we’ll bring you short interviews with classical artists and organizations — our interview with Charlottesville Symphony conductor Ben Rous airs next week. Plus composer features, new classical album reviews, and an opera spotlight.

You’ll also hear weekly arts features from UVA’s Creative Writing program, the Fralin and Kluge-Ruhe museums, Virginia Film Festival, and many more.

Evening and weekend classical programs will continue to provide deep dives into special classical sub-genres.

PLUS: Later this summer, we’re relaunching the Charlottesville Classical website and its 24/7 local classical radio stream. The site will serve as a hub for local classical music, and offer a fresh, locally hosted classical service around the clock.
